Clone React App
git clone my-app
Start and install packages
cd my-app
npm install
Run project!
npm run start
Please implement a simple website using ReactJS + Typescript, that would allow displaying Github user's public repositories. The main page should have an input and allow a user to enter Github's username. The second page would display available repositories for the entered user, and the thrid page would display the list of files in the repo + content of the selected respository.
As a result you can either zip with the project or send the link to a git repository. Please provide instructions how to run the project.
Don't bother with design. Here are main criterias for project evaluation:
- Code quality
- Using the best practices
- Project structure
- Test coverage
- Any other good practices.